
Civil Engineer Program
Field Engineering and Readiness Lab (FERL) is a five-week program that provides opportunities for a limited number of Air Force ROTC cadets with entry-level civil engineering (CE) courses to get hands-on work experience in the CE career field.
FERL provides qualified cadets with:
- An introduction to the basics of civil engineering
- Practical "hands-on" construction experiences
- An engineering "feel" for the capabilities of construction equipment
- Experience working with both military and Air Force Academy instructors on actual CE projects at various Air Force bases and at Air Force Academy
Training consists of two weeks working with CE at a designated Air Force base and 3 weeks of hands-on construction activities at the Air Force Academy.
The course is presented in three blocks:
Surveying
Learn the basic principles of engineering measurement and
get hands-on experience with different types of surveying
equipment
Computer Applications
Gain an appreciation of how computers may be used to aid in
solving engineering problems
Construction Materials
Highlights include performing structural tests and housing
contstruction for a Pueblo, Colorado Indian Reservation
